House Bill 2031 Summary
-
Repeals Title 3, Chapter 3, Article 4.2 (relates to iceberg lettuce regulations) and multiple licensing boards and regulatory agencies including the acupuncture board of examiners, barbers and cosmetology board, and others.
-
Consolidates certain health profession regulatory functions by merging the board of homeopathic and integrated medicine examiners with the acupuncture board of examiners staff and administrative support.
-
Removes references to repealed boards from fingerprint clearance card requirements, health profession definitions, and administrative hearing procedures throughout Arizona Revised Statutes.
-
Eliminates statutory provisions related to school bus advisory councils and student transportation advisory councils, transferring some school transportation rulemaking authority to the department of public safety.
-
Prohibits state agencies from entering into contracts with lobbying firms or spending public funds on lobbyists unless the person is a state employee.
